Selecting Mobile Plans: Postpaid vs. Prepaid That Suits You

Are you confounded about the right mobile plan for your needs? Battling this decision is common, especially with the wealth of check here options available. Two popular choices are postpaid and prepaid plans, each with distinct attributes. Recognizing these differences can help you make the perfect plan that suits your lifestyle and budget.

Postpaid plans typically require a contract and involve paying your bill every month. They often come with perks like unlimited data, free international calls, and exclusive discounts. Prepaid plans, on the other hand, are more versatile. You purchase a set amount of talk time and data upfront, and you can reload your balance as needed. Prepaid plans offer ease and authority over your spending.

Discovering the Benefits of eSIM for Mobile Connectivity

eSIM technology is revolutionizing mobile connectivity, offering a selection of benefits over traditional SIM cards. With an eSIM, you can effortlessly activate cellular service directly on your device without needing a physical SIM card. This expedites the process of switching carriers or securing new service plans.

Furthermore, eSIMs boost security by providing a more protected method of storing your mobile data. They also support multiple profiles on a single device, allowing you to toggle between different carriers or data plans with ease.

The adaptability of eSIMs is another significant advantage. Integrated directly into your device, they eliminate the need for physical SIM cards, making them ideal for a extensive range of devices, including smartphones, tablets, and even wearables.
